P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To precisely estimate a surface friction coefficient in a short time.;SOLUTION: A reference yaw angle acceleration arithmetic part 5 calculates a reference yaw angle acceleration on the basis of steering angle δ, yaw rate γand lateral acceleration Gy supplied from a filter 4. The yaw rate γ supplied from the filter 4 is differentiated to calculate actual yaw angle acceleration. A computing element 7 subtracts the reference yaw angle acceleration from the actual yaw angle acceleration to calculate residual error err. A minimum square method arithmetic part 8 calculates the inclination a of the lateral acceleration Gy to the residual error err. A μ estimation part 9 estimates surface friction coefficient μ, when it is judged that the inclination a exceeds a prescribed threshold TH, on the basis of the lateral acceleration Gy at that time.;COPYRIGHT: (C)2003,JPO
